What do the pros use the PowerFoamer for? SONAX's compressed-air foam atomiser runs off your compressor and lays active foam across the whole car for the pre-wash — it coats the panels with concentrated cleaning foam and lets you loosen dirt gently, with barely any contact, before you ever touch the paint.
A proper wash doesn't start with the wash mitt — it starts with foam. In modern detailing businesses and car-wash setups, the low-contact pre-wash is a fixed part of the routine: active foam goes onto the dirty paint, pulls off grime, road film and organic residue without any mechanical contact — and cuts the risk of wash marks and holograms right down. The SONAX PROFILINE PowerFoamer is the pro tool for that step: compressor-driven, high foam output, and built for all-day use in a busy operation.
The low-contact pre-wash with active foam has come a long way in pro detailing over the last few years. Once you're switched on to the holograms, sanding marks and micro-scratches that careless contact washing leaves behind, you start rethinking the whole wash. The upshot: a two-stage process — low-contact pre-wash, then contact wash — has settled in as the standard. The PowerFoamer is the tool that nails that first step, cleanly and quickly.
The gap between foam off a PowerFoamer and foam from a simple spray bottle is obvious the moment you see it: the PowerFoamer puts down a creamy, stable foam with real cling that lays evenly across the panel. Spray-bottle foam is watery, runs off faster and gets far less dwell time on vertical surfaces. For proper results on an active-foam pre-wash, the difference in foam quality and dwell efficiency is huge.
Day-to-day from Detailing1: For the best foam, mix your concentrate at roughly 1:10 to 1:20 in the vessel, depending on how thick and how aggressive you want it. SONAX PROFILINE ActiFoam Energy as the active-foam concentrate is dialled in for the PowerFoamer system: the foam clings well on vertical panels and has enough cleaning power for medium to heavy road grime. Let it dwell for 3–5 minutes, then rinse it all off with a pressure washer — and only then do you go in with the contact wash. The principle: foam loosens, the pressure washer takes it away, the mitt just finishes off.
The SONAX PROFILINE PowerFoamer uses compressed air from a compressor to whip cleaning concentrate and water into a stable foam. It's the same idea as a pro kitchen's whipped-cream siphon: force a gas (air) into a liquid under pressure and you get a stable foam or cream. On a foam atomiser for car washing, that gives you a dense, creamy active foam that clings well and stays put on the panel for a good while.
The foam-generator head sets the consistency: different nozzle settings let you switch between a finer, clingy high-foam and a coarser, more aggressive wet foam. Fine high-foam suits delicate surfaces and freshly sealed cars; coarse wet foam is the one for filthy cars with stubborn road-film build-up. That flexibility on foam consistency is something simple hand-pump foam sprayers just don't give you.
The PowerFoamer's pressure vessel is made from a hard-wearing material that stands up to solvent-based cleaning concentrates. In day-to-day pro use, foam atomisers get filled with all sorts of concentrates — a vessel that gets eaten away by harsh cleaners, or starts leaking, is a safety and efficiency risk. SONAX builds the PROFILINE accessories to pro standard for daily, non-stop use.
You hook the PowerFoamer up to a compressor through standard compressed-air fittings, the kind already sitting in any pro workshop or detailing operation. Working pressure sits in the usual compressor range of 4–8 bar — no special kit needed. That makes moving over to an air-driven foam system painless for anyone already running a compressor.
When you set up the foam generator, the air-to-liquid ratio is what makes or breaks it: too much air gives you a dry, unstable foam that collapses fast and barely clings. Too little air gives you a wet, heavy foam that runs straight off. The sweet spot is in the middle: a creamy foam that holds on vertical panels for at least 3–4 minutes. Where that sits depends on the concentrate you're using and your water hardness, so you dial it in once for your own setup.
Running the PowerFoamer follows a clear sequence: fill the vessel with concentrate and water, connect the air, lay down the foam, let it dwell, rinse off. The whole foam pre-wash step takes between 5 and 15 minutes depending on the size of the car — time you get back through less mechanical work later in the hand-wash step. Less dirt on the paint when the mitt hits it means less scratch risk.
If you've got a lot of cars going through, it's worth getting a few vessels so one can be filling while the other's in use. The PowerFoamer is quick to clean between vessel swaps: a few pulls of foam with clean water flushes the residue out of the system. A deeper clean at the end of the day with a rinse-through stops shampoo residue building up in the nozzles.

SONAX PROFILINE FoamSprayer is the option for shops or private users without a compressed-air supply: the FoamSprayer runs off a built-in pressure pump and gives you similar foam quality, just on manual pumping. To get started, or for the odd job, the FoamSprayer is the more accessible pick — for daily pro use the PowerFoamer is more efficient and easier on the body.
Put the air-driven PowerFoamer head to head with a hand-pumped foam sprayer and the difference shows up mostly over a full day: on one car it's marginal — on ten cars a day, the PowerFoamer's ergonomics and its steady foam quality are what count. A hand pump tires out, the pressure fades, the foam quality drops off as the day goes on. The PowerFoamer puts out the same foam on the last car as it did on the first.
Against pro foam lances for pressure washers, the PowerFoamer is a different category of kit: high-pressure foam lances use the pressure washer's water pressure to make the foam. The foam those systems make is often less stable and less clingy than the air-driven PowerFoamer's. On top of that, high-pressure foam lances only work tied to a pressure washer — the PowerFoamer stands on its own and works as your only foam system.
For shops that need both a PROFILINE DruckpumpZerstäuber for specialist cleaners and a foam system for the pre-wash, SONAX has both categories in the PROFILINE range. The DruckpumpZerstäuber handles the targeted, single-spot job; the PowerFoamer takes on the wide-area foam. The two cover each other in a pro cleaning workflow.
